**WHAT IS A DIGITAL MARKETING SPECIALIST?**
The Digital Marketing Specialists at HealthTrust Workforce Solutions are responsible for developing quality, on-brand content in an effort to attract healthcare professionals and healthcare facilities to engage with our brand. A successful Digital Marketing Specialist will focus on increasing brand awareness, promoting our company values, and creating effective and engaging content that resonates with our audience. You will also work to initiate effective marketing campaigns through our social media and blog channels to translate business goals and relevant communications to our internal and external audiences.
